My list of things I thought of so far...

1) better menu/display, better MCU that allows for upload of files over the network (octoprint is nice, but it's not awesome for things like resuming prints after power failure and uploading via octoprint over 115200 bps is SLOOW). With a better MCU, could emulate "serial port" in the MCU and allow 10Mbps or faster.

2) possibility for dual X axis with one extruder each (and then, dual MMU2.0)

3) automatic measuring of filament size (ie, caliper sensor, could be same sensor as filament trigger sensor)

4) MMU2.0 selfcalibration using the filament sensor

5) extruder feed failure detection (ie, extruder motor can't feed the filament should stop the printer)

My idea would combine the filament width sensor with the bondtech gear, so that you can both measure the width and if the bondtech gear are slipping ("click!"). It should be doable with a simple calibrated potentiometer for the distance (angle?) -> A/D converter. Probably not too hard to get a resolution near 0.001mm.

Say a slide potentiometer with the "base" fixed to one axis and the "handle" fixed to the other axis of the bondtech.

you could add a linear encoder to avoid shifting at least on the X axis with the sensor on the x carriage, it's almost always because of the x carriage that we have layer shift.
That would make a closed loop control and that would prevent or recover/save(or even stop) the end of the print when a layer has shifted
and that could be very useful (and it's not very expensive and not so hard to do 🙂 )
(speaking from experience, i have often shifted layers when i use 0.10 or 0.05mm layer height)
ps: and still using stepper motor

Add a +1 for this.
I just did a 30+ hour print and I had about a 8mm shift in the last few hours. Now I will have to saw the piece in half and glue it together.
A absolute optical encoder strip, like that used on wide carriage printers would be fairly cheap and could be used on X & Y axis movement.
Another cheap way out would be to have a center of axis travel sensor that would at least allow for a axis reset if it did not trigger when it was suppose to.

One consideration is that, no matter how fast your printer, you still are printing filaments that have their own limitations on temperatures and speeds. The Mk3 can already print beyond the speeds recommended by most filament manufacturers. While the mechanics might be improved to do so with better quality, I think you're also asking for Prusament to start providing high-speed filaments. At the price of low-end PLA today. Off Amazon.
